There are three main reasons to cut back your hedges. First there is the aesthetic—an overgrown hedge is unsightly and potentially dangerous, so trimming it back improves the look and safety of your property. Second, there is the health of the hedge—professional hedge trimmers will ensure that dead, dying, or diseased branches are removed, reducing the risk to the rest of the hedge. Finally, it promotes more robust growth. When a hedge is properly trimmed, its branches grow back thicker and more densely packed, ensuring a healthy and resilient hedge.
